Perbaiki render data tabel penilai

- Tambahkan pengecekan null untuk beberapa field (debitur, branch, user, tujuan_penilaian, jenis_fasilitas_kredit) agar mencegah error saat data tidak tersedia.
- Pastikan tampilkan '-' jika data terkait tidak ada.
This commit is contained in:
Daeng Deni Mardaeni
2024-12-27 16:11:12 +07:00
parent 8e2a241671
commit 37eb6ac929

View File

@@ -199,19 +199,28 @@
},
user_id: {
title: 'User Pemohon',
render: (item, data) => `${data.user.name}`,
render: (item, data) => {
return data.user && data.user.name ? `${data.user.name}` : '-';
},
},
branch_id: {
title: 'Cabang Pemohon',
render: (item, data) => `${data.branch.name}`,
render: (item, data) => {
return data.branch && data.branch.name ? `${data.branch.name}` : '-';
},
},
debitur_id: {
title: 'Debitur',
render: (item, data) => `${data.debiture.name}`,
render: (item, data) => {
return data.debiture && data.debiture.name ? `${data.debiture.name}` : '-';
},
},
tujuan_penilaian_id: {
title: 'Tujuan Penilaian',
render: (item, data) => `${data.tujuan_penilaian.name}`,
render: (item, data) => {
return data.tujuan_penilaian && data.tujuan_penilaian.name ? `${data.tujuan_penilaian.name}` : '-';
},
},
status: {
title: 'Status',